DSGMC To Open Educational Institutes For Sikligar, Wanjara Sikhs

2012-11-05-sikligarNEW DELHI—The Delhi Sikh Gurdwara Management Committee (DSGMC) has began a scheme for the welfare of the new generations of Sikh families. The scheme was started for the children of families who are economically weak and socially backward, and were unable to attain education.

The scheme was started by DSGMC president Mr. Manjit Singh G.K. who announced for opening of industrial training institute cum professional training institute and a middle school for in Mangolpuri and Budh vihar areas.

The school and ITI would serve young generations Sikligar, Wanjarey and Lobana Sikhs of Mangolpuri and Sultanpuri localities who suffered the most during 1984 anti-Sikh genocide.

Mr. G.K. said that the schools and professional training institute was being opened as per a poll manifesto before DSGMC polls. The president of DSGMC adds that the Gurdwara committee would make all efforts to help Sikh children get education at a very competitive and affordable cost. DSGMC member Mr. Jasbir Singh Jassi and local leader Mr. Mohan Singh and Mr. Roop Singh were also present.
